As a Data Center Technician , you serve as one of many primary resolvers for your support team, skilled at troubleshooting and resolving complex hardware infrastructure issues. You support and share knowledge of these technologies with team members. You possess basic to intermediate system administration skills and work autonomously to resolve server issues. You understand all aspects of the equipment you support. You know how to take direction when given, paying attention to all details involved. You work well with a team. You are receptive to feedback and able to adjust performance and behavior as required for the position.
